Review summary

Created with AI, based on recent reviews

Reviewers had a great experience with this company. Customers consistently praise the platform for its ease of use and intuitive design, highlighting how simple it is to navigate and get started. Many people appreciate the clean user interface and the smooth operation of the website. The product itself is frequently described as powerful and effective, with users noting its ability to simplify tasks like creating email funnels, landing pages, and selling products. Reviewers also commend the staff for their helpfulness and positive attitude, often describing them as knowledgeable and responsive. However, some customers also noted issues with customer service, mentioning experiences where replies were unhelpful or that there was no real customer service available. A few other people also felt that the platform was not intuitive in certain areas, leading to confusion with visual automations or difficulty finding specific features.

Rated 1 out of 5 stars

What a let down

Set up a paid account to do drip emails for a digital product hosted on my company's website. Mentioned an affiliate link (for legit product) and all of a sudden, my account is disabled. I follow instructions to reinstate account and answer all questions asked by "customer support." I even offer to remove the one email that mentions affiliate products. Instead, I am told my "case will be kicked to another approval dept and could take 2-4 days. My company is legit and could be searched and immediately verified. Busy entrepreneurs don't have time for games. I offered to provide any and all info to verify my account. Awful experience. Glad I figured it out right away, instead of when the email drip campaign was live and integrated. Lesson learned: always build proprietary internal systems if you know how to - otherwise some algorithm could decide your account needs to be shut down at random.

Rated 1 out of 5 stars

Lack of Transparency, Functionality, and Ability to Tell the Truth

This platform has more than a few issues. It doesn't have the basic functionality that other platforms such as Constant Contact and Mailchimp have had for YEARS such as directly testing links in preview.

And last year, they raised their prices 50% without telling customers that email campaigns sent from their platform would not render in Outlook - affecting reach to the 1.2 MILLION companies that use Outlook. I confirmed this with Microsoft.
When you reach out to Kit support, they spend a ridiculous amount of time skirting around whatever the real issue is, often to cover up the fact that they have no idea how to fix their functionality issues.

It appears their focus has been on marketing and courting the so-called influencers" and building a creator network that is supposed to increase engagement, but does absolutely nothing. Paying these "influencers" is probably why the price hike was done.

Couple that with the complete and total arrogance of the support team, which will never admit that they don't have the technical expertise or capability to fix the issues that plague its platform. Just saying they disagree with Microsoft's assessment that the Kit platform is not compatible with Outlook, is supposed to gaslight customers into thinking they have any idea at all about what they're talking about. They won't even have a conversation with Microsoft to determine where the gaps are in their deliverability.

In sum, Kit is basically comprised of a bunch of toddlers cosplaying as experts in the email marketing space. They are incapable of sitting at the table with mature platforms like Outlook, or other IT specialists who troubleshoot compatibility issues for a global corporations on a regular basis.

Avoid Convert/Kit if you don't want the heartburn of having to re-platform when you find out the hard way how bad it really is.
